Whispers of the Forbidden Path
In the secluded mountains of the Azure Sky Range, the whispers of ancient wisdom have long been whispered by the wind. These whispers speak of a cultivation secret that could change the fate of the world, hidden within the walls of the ethereal temple known as the Forbidden Path. Only those with the purest of hearts and the strongest will can venture into its depths.
Ling Hua, a young cultivator known for her unparalleled skill in the martial arts of the realm, heard these whispers during a meditation session in her secluded cave. She felt an inexplicable pull towards the Forbidden Path, as if it called to her soul. She dismissed it as a mere figment of her overactive imagination until the night when her dreams were filled with visions of a forgotten legacy.
The next morning, she found herself at the entrance of the temple, its ancient doors standing as a testament to the power and mystery that lay within. The temple was surrounded by a dense fog that seemed to seep into her very bones. She hesitated for a moment, but the pull was too strong. With a determined look, she pushed open the creaking doors and stepped inside.
The temple was a labyrinth of corridors, each stone wall etched with intricate carvings of ancient symbols. Ling Hua followed the whispers, her heart pounding with anticipation and fear. She found herself in a large chamber, the walls adorned with ancient runes and glowing crystals. In the center of the chamber stood a pedestal with an open book on top, the pages glowing with a faint, pulsating light.
Curiosity piqued, Ling Hua approached the pedestal. As she reached out to touch the book, a sudden gust of wind blew through the chamber, causing the symbols to flicker and the crystals to dim. A voice echoed through the temple, a voice that seemed to come from everywhere and nowhere.
"The secret you seek is not of this world, Ling Hua," the voice said, its tone both comforting and foreboding. "It is a legacy that binds the realms, a power that can alter the very fabric of reality."
Ling Hua's eyes widened in shock as the book began to turn itself, the pages revealing ancient cultivation techniques and forbidden spells. She realized that this was no ordinary book; it was a guide to a path that could only be walked by one with a pure heart and a strong will.
As she began to read, the whispers grew louder, pulling her deeper into the temple. She felt a strange connection to the book, as if it were a part of her soul. The symbols on the walls began to glow brighter, and the air grew thick with energy. The temple seemed to change around her, the walls shifting and moving, creating new paths and challenges.
Ling Hua faced her first trial. A massive stone guardian, its eyes glowing red, blocked her path. It moved with a grace that belied its immense power, and its voice was a rumble that shook the ground.
"You seek the forbidden path, but you are not worthy," the guardian growled. "You must prove your worth."
Ling Hua, unflinching, stepped forward. She focused on her breath, her mind emptying of all distractions. She called upon the martial arts she had honed for years, the techniques that had won her a place among the elite cultivators of her realm. She engaged the guardian in a fierce battle, her movements swift and precise.
The guardian was a formidable opponent, its attacks overwhelming and relentless. Ling Hua fought with all her might, using the techniques from the book to counter each blow. The battle raged on for what felt like hours, but she held her ground, her resolve unwavering.
Finally, the guardian's attacks grew weaker, and its movements grew slower. Ling Hua saw her opening and struck with everything she had. The guardian let out a final, mournful roar before collapsing in a heap of stone and dust.
The temple seemed to sigh in relief as Ling Hua stepped over the guardian's lifeless form. The path ahead was clear, and the whispers grew louder still. She continued on, her heart filled with a newfound sense of purpose.
The deeper she ventured, the more the temple seemed to change. The walls shimmered with colors she had never seen before, and the air was thick with an energy that was both exhilarating and terrifying. She felt as though she were walking through the very fabric of reality itself.
Finally, she reached a chamber that seemed to pulse with power. In the center of the chamber stood an ancient, ornate mirror. The mirror's surface was covered in intricate carvings, and it seemed to hum with energy.
"The mirror shows the true nature of your heart," the voice of the whispers said. "If you are worthy, it will reveal the secret you seek."
Ling Hua approached the mirror, her heart pounding in her chest. She looked into its depths, and she saw her reflection, but it was not the reflection of her current form. It was a reflection of her past, of her mistakes, and of her greatest strengths.
The mirror's surface began to glow, and images from her past flooded her mind. She saw herself as a young girl, naive and unaware of the world's dangers. She saw herself as a warrior, facing countless battles and emerging victorious. She saw herself as a friend, sacrificing everything for those she loved.
As the images played out, Ling Hua realized that the true secret of the Forbidden Path was not in the techniques or the spells, but in the journey itself. It was about facing her own fears and weaknesses, about learning from her past, and about growing into the person she was meant to be.
The mirror's glow intensified, and a voice resonated within her mind.
"You have proven your worth, Ling Hua. The secret you seek is within you. Use it wisely."
With that, the mirror shattered into a thousand pieces, and Ling Hua found herself standing in the temple's entrance, the whispers now gone. She looked around, realizing that she had already returned to the world she knew.
She knew that her journey was far from over. The secrets of the Forbidden Path had changed her, and she had to decide how she would use the power she had found within herself. She knew that she had to face the challenges that lay ahead, with her heart and her mind as her weapons.
Ling Hua took a deep breath, her eyes filled with determination. She stepped out of the temple, the sun warming her face. She was ready to walk the path that had been laid out before her, ready to face whatever came next, with the knowledge that the true power of the Forbidden Path resided within her own heart.
